Examples of Impactful Projects

Developing lead scoring models to improve follow-up prioritization across dealership networks

Identifying misaligned inventory based on lead trends and recommending allocation adjustments

Forecasting sales performance using historical trends and lead activity, enabling the client to proactively adjust digital media spend and inventory planning to meet monthly targets.

Building a Power BI dashboard that integrates website engagement, advertising spend, and sales performance, giving stakeholders a single view of cross-channel ROI and helping inform future investment decisions.
